Taxonomic Classification

Rank Burdock Conch Pale flax
Kingdom Animalia (Animals) Plantae (Plants)
Phylum Arthropoda (Arthropods)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ants)
Class Insecta (Insects) Magnoliopsida (Dicots)
Order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) Malpighiales (Malpighiales)
Family Tortricidae Linaceae
Genus Aethes Linum
Species Aethes rubigana Linum bienne
